Section 33-10-112 - Report of performance as court-martial member, witness, or counsel prohibited

Ask AI about this
33-10-112. Report of performance as court-martial member, witness, or counsel prohibited.In the preparation of an effectiveness, fitness, or efficiency report, or any other report or document used in whole or in part for the purpose of determining whether a member of the state military forces is qualified to be advanced in grade, or in determining the assignment or transfer of a member of the state military forces, or in determining whether a member of the state military forces should be retained on active status, no person subject to this code may, in preparing any such report:(1)Consider or evaluate the performance of duty of any such member as a member of a court-martial or witness in a court-martial; or(2)Give a less favorable rating or evaluation of any counsel of the accused because of zealous representation before a court-martial. Source: SL 2012, ch 175, §93.
